2-3. Va/Vs Voltage Adjustment

2-3-1. Required Equipment

. Digital multi meter
. Signal generator
Input signal: Input1 (RGB, D-Sub) 852 x 480@60 Hz
(Recommended pattern), 100 % white
pattern

2-3-2. Vs Voltage Adjustment

1. Check the label on the right upper side of PDP panel
2. Turn the volume (1VR600) to be "Vs Voltage" on the
label.
It is normally set in the range between 180 V and 195 V.

2-3-3. Va Voltage Adjustment

1. Look at the label on the right upper side of PDP panel
2. Then turn the volume (1VR700) to be "Va Voltage"
on the label.
It is normally set in the range between 55 V and 65 V.

2-4. Vsc/_ _ _ _ _ Vy Voltage Adjustment
After replacing the Y SUS board, perform the adjustment
in this section.
2-4-1. Required Equipment
. Digital multimeter
. Signal generator
Input signal: InputI (RGB, D-Sub) 852 x 480@60 Hz
(Recommended pattern), 100% white
pattern

2-4-2. Vsc Voltage Adjustment

1. Perform the adjustment so that the following
specification is satisfied.
Adjustment point: R53
Specification:
See below
2-4-3. _ _ _ _ _ Vy Voltage Adjustment
1. Perform the adjustment so that the following
specification is satisfied.
Adjustment point: R78
